Industry experts are cautioning bar patrons about a prohibited practice known as “bottle marrying,” in which leftover liquor from one bottle is poured into another rather than being discarded. Although some bartenders claim the technique helps reduce waste or consolidate nearly empty bottles, federal regulations governing distilled spirits strictly prohibit refilling or combining bottles once they have been opened. The rule is intended to preserve product integrity, maintain accurate tax reporting, and protect consumer safety.
